Scrum и Kanban — гибкие подходы к разработке программного обеспечения. В их основе лежат принципы Agile, которые подразумевают быструю реакцию на постоянно меняющиеся условия среды и обратную связь от пользователей на каждом цикле работы. Какие именно задачи решает QA-специалист, какие навыки ему нужны в работе и как им стать — расскажем в нашем материале. Нефункциональное тестирование показывает, насколько удобно приложение само по себе, его производительность на разных устройствах, надёжность и так далее. В примере с банковским приложением это будут проверки работоспособности двухфакторной авторизации или удобство расположения элементов навигации для пользователей.
Однако специалисты среднего и высокого уровня по-прежнему востребованы на рынке. Помимо всех этих технических навыков, есть навыки, которые трудно измерить, но они не менее важны. Внимательность, усидчивость, умение выражать свои мысли ясно и внятно, коммуникабельность, стрессоустойчивость — вот качества, которые сделают из QA-инженера настоящего мастера.
Почему Импортозамещение Не Работает
Кто-то выбирает самостоятельное обучение, а кто-то готовые онлайн- или очные курсы. Сеньор пишет план тестирования ПО, описывает сложные тест-кейсы и принимает результаты работы джуниоров и мидлов. Специалист разрабатывает и описывает метрики качества и следит за их достижением. Для QA-инженеров, как и других айтишников, существует система грейдов, классифицирующая их по опыту, навыкам и уровню зарплаты.
Разобраться в темах помогут статьи, обучающие видео и форумы профессионалов. Для этого тестировщик много общается с коллегами, изучает работу сервиса и всегда держит руку на пульсе. В среде, где бизнес постоянно растёт и следует технологическим трендам, нельзя находиться на одном и том же уровне — можно устареть в видении рабочих задач. Финальная задача — это проанализировать проблемную ситуацию, придумать, как ее избежать в будущем и задокументировать свои наработки. Поэтому инженеры по обеспечению качества работают в тесной связке с программистами.
Он проверяет работу приложения на соответствие требованиям заказчика и стандартам качества. При этом все тестировщики используют разные инструменты для автоматизации, управления тестовым процессом и обеспечения качества продукта. Далее перечислим самые популярные инструменты для разных сфер тестирования.
Отсюда достаточно распространенное мнение, что пройти собеседование и войти в айти проще, чем кажется. Поэтому стоит разобраться в этом вопросе более детально и проверить, насколько это соответствует действительности. Не забудьте разобраться в инструментах управления проектами, например с Jira. Это поможет вам лучше понимать, что влияет на качество продукта. Дело в том, что в ближайшее время вам придётся посвятить себя учёбе и поиску работы — самостоятельно или в онлайн-школах.
Тестирование лишь часть этого процесса, а задача QA – эффективно интегрировать его с разработкой. Ручное тестирование уже отличается от QA тестирования. Qa-инженер Кто Это Чем Занимается И Как Им Стать У мануального тестировщика ограниченно поле действий — это специалист, который занимается тестированием программного обеспечения вручную.
Именно таким профессионалам работодатели предлагают достойную зарплату. Еще лет через пять вполне реально дослужиться до тимлида – руководителя группы тестировщиков. Для этой должности требуются профессиональные возможности и компетенции, владение основами менеджмента, умение мыслить глобально и решать сложные задачи. В сети существуют платформы для краудтестинга, куда компании выкладывают свои программные продукты и предлагают всем желающим протестировать их на конкретном устройстве и ОС. Это хороший шанс заполучить реальный проект и проверить свои силы.
Об этом говорит в своём интервью на hh.ru руководитель департамента обеспечения качества ПО Veeam Software Игорь Кацев. Работа тестировщика — это бесконечное приближение к совершенству. Невозможно проверить всё, поэтому тестировщик должен работать так, чтобы совершить минимум действий, но найти максимум ошибок.
Сколько Зарабатывает Qa-инженер
Такой подход серьезно оптимизирует процесс разработки. Без QA невозможно в адекватные сроки выпустить работающий продукт. QA-инженер анализирует требования, плотно общается с менеджерами и бизнес-аналитиками, чтобы четко понимать, что нужно сделать.
Linkedin также можно отметить как благоприятное место для поиска работы. Также важно иметь аналитический склад ума и умение быстро и точно анализировать информацию. Это позволит тестировщику эффективно находить и исправлять ошибки в программном обеспечении.
Чем Занимается Тестировщик?
IT-компании, занимающиеся разработкой игр, приложений для ПК и мобильных гаджетов для миллионов людей, порой не в состоянии проверить все возможные сценарии пользовательского поведения. Ручное тестирование — самый простой способ оценки качества приложения. Однако тестировать приложение вручную — «дорогая» операция, так как скорость и точность проверок ограничена возможностями тестировщиков.
Однако, работа может быть трудоемкой и монотонной, что может быть вызывать утомление и выгорание. Очень важно соблюдать баланс работы и отдыха, и тогда эта профессия не покажется вам скучной. Middle — это специалист, который уже имеет определенный опыт работы в области тестирования и может выполнять более сложные задачи. Он умеет работать с различными инструментами и методами тестирования, а также может участвовать в разработке тест-планов и тест-кейсов.
Направления, зарплаты и перспективы в работе современных инженеров. Тестировщик Рулит» — туториалы, книги по QA, тесты и разборы вопросов с собеседований. Инженер по качеству нужен компаниям, которые работают с программным обеспечением. Такие специалисты востребованы в сфере IT, маркетинга, промышленного производства, фармакологии, логистики. 📌 Работа в команде — чтобы учитывать мнение других специалистов, но при этом аргументировать собственную позицию.
Тестировщик: Кто Это, Что Делает, Как Им Стать И Что Должен Знать Специалист По Тестированию
Это место, где вы можете отыскать свежие вакансии, полезные советы для работы, а также рекомендации от экспертов из разных уголков России. Как видите, профессия QA-инженера открыта для всех желающих и существует множество путей, которые ведут к её освоению. Важно только найти подход, который вам больше подходит, и начать свое обучение.
Его главная задача — создание и поддержка автоматических тестовых сценариев для проверки функциональности, надежности, производительности и безопасности приложения. Важно также уметь работать в команде и быть готовым к постоянному обучению и совершенствованию навыков. Тестировщик или QA Engineer — это специалист, который занимается тестированием ПО для выявления и устранения ошибок и недочетов.
Роль Qa-инженера В Разработке Программного Обеспечения
Тестировщик подтверждает, что продукт соответствует всем ожиданиям клиента, постоянно проверяет, не конфликтуют ли обновления между собой, ищет источник ошибки в функционировании. Это достаточно однообразные действия, которые требуют концентрации внимания. Из софт-скиллов — дотошность, усидчивость, внимательность к мелочам, умение не только планировать, но и придерживаться своего плана. QA-инженеров на постоянной основе ищут крупные компании — «Сбер», «Авито», «Яндекс», HH.ru, VK, «Ланит», «Тинькофф», Playrix, Ozon, Kaspersky и многие другие. Скорее всего, вакансия QA будет открыта в любой IT-компании, которая вам нравится.
- Потенциальный работодатель обязательно отметит для себя этот пункт в резюме соискателя.
- Джуниор выполняет тест-кейсы, которые для него составили мидл или сеньор QA-инженеры.
- Это место, где вы можете отыскать свежие вакансии, полезные советы для работы, а также рекомендации от экспертов из разных уголков России.
- QA-инженер должен уметь правильно подходить к решению задач и самостоятельно придумывать новые решения.
- Тестировщик напоминает профессора, который принимает финальный экзамен, а QA-инженер — лектора, который проводит промежуточные контрольные.
У документации есть стандартный вид и ее всегда сохраняют даже после сдачи проекта. ⚡ Если вы задумываетесь о старте в IT, но не знаете, с чего начать, QA может стать подходящим вариантом. Чтобы начать работать в сфере, понадобятся базовые знания в разработке и тестировании. Получить их можно из книг, на бесплатных курсах, в телеграм-каналах, на образовательных вебинарах.
Если же вам больше нравится структурированное обучение, есть ряд онлайн-курсов, которые систематизируют информацию и предоставляют практические задания, помогающие освоить реальные задачи. Вход в профессию QA-инженера лучше начинать с обучения на тестировщика, постепенно добавляя новые знания и умения в своё резюме. При самообучении стоит выбирать программы, акцентирующие внимание на практике, где студенты учатся проектировать тесты и проверять мобильные и веб-сервисы.